Fundamentals of Sediment Removal with Sand Traps and Retention Tanks

Sand traps and retention tanks operate on the principle of gravity separation. As water entries into the tank, its flow velocity decreases, allowing heavier particles such as sand and sediments to settle at the bottom. The retention tank then holds these sediments, preventing their recirculation and safeguarding downstream components. Properly sized tanks optimize this process, ensuring sediments are captured and retained effectively.

Factors to Consider When Selecting the Proper Tank Size

Accurate tank sizing depends on understanding your household water consumption and sediment load. Key considerations include:

  • Water Flow Rate: Estimating the typical volume of water passing through your system helps determine how much sediment needs to be captured at any given time.
  • Sediment Load: The quantity of sand and particles entering your water source influences the tank volume required to prevent resuspension and ensure effective retention.
  • Retention Time: Sufficient tank volume allows enough residence time for sediments to settle before water moves downstream.

What local testing usually reveals

Water testing in this area typically reveals sediment levels that can vary significantly due to local geology and rainfall patterns. Tests often show elevated concentrations of sand and silt, particularly after heavy precipitation. Homeowners should look for results indicating total suspended solids (TSS), which measure the cloudiness caused by particles in the water. A high TSS level suggests the need for a reliable sediment management solution. Additionally, it's important to assess the pH and mineral content, as these factors can influence sediment behavior and the overall quality of the water supply. Understanding these results helps in determining the right capacity for a sand trap retention tank and sediment filter.
